The EVS Operations Manager ensures that all managers and supervisors have the knowledge, skill and competency to oversee their assigned areas of responsibilities. The EVS Operations Manager will also collaboratively and respectfully educate, mentor and support his/her management team in providing leadership in the completion of department responsibilities, including supporting the allocation of staff, equipment and supply resources to fulfill the department's cleaning responsibilities. The EVS Operations Manager will have knowledge of all technical aspects of the hospital's cleaning procedures, project work and specialty cleaning. In addition, the EVS Operations Manager is responsible for building relationships with nursing leadership and other supported departments, utilizing these relationships to communicate with and listen to the customers' needs and ensuring that the management team carries out and properly documents department quality assurance activities. Required Minimum Knowledge, Skills, and Abilities (KSAs)
Education:
Two-year degree or five years of leadership experience in a related field. Four-year degree preferred.
License/Certifications:
N/A Experience:
See "Education." Experience in managing multiple services preferred. Experience supervising managers and working with a staff of 30+. Interpersonal skills necessary in order to communicate effectively with subordinates and a variety of hospital personnel. Leadership skills. Interpersonal skills necessary to build effective relationships with peers and customers. Analytical skills necessary to effectively contribute to hospital and department decisions. Ability to prepare reports by utilizing hospital and department computerized software programs.
